Other Features
- Open, circumaural dynamic stereo headphones
- Outstanding soundstage with a warm and balanced audio reproduction
- Specially-tuned, highly efficient drivers capable of delivering high sound pressure levels
- Highly optimised ventilated magnet system minimises air turbulence and harmonic, intermodulation distortion
- Open-back ear cups facilitate transparent sound while showcasing cutting-edge industrial design
- Ultra comfortable and luxurious velour earpads, silicone-treated headband for minimal headband resonance
- Innovative and highly aesthetic dual-material yoke for better stability and eliminates negative influences to sound quality
- Very low THD achieved by top-notch and extremely stable internal damping element
- Symmetrical and detachable silver-plated oxygen-free four-wire copper cable for better conductivity at higher frequencies
- Designed in Germany, assembled in Ireland
